EXCLUSIVE: ICM motion picture literary agent Sophy Holodnik is
leaving to become a manager at Echo Lake. Talent agents Steven Fisher and John Sacks will also depart. As Deadline already reported, ICM recently hired three new agents and promoted four coordinators to agents in the motion picture and television departments.
